EVENT | A Night With…Soul Clap

On Saturday 9th June, Boston party starters and masters of the slow jam, Soul Clap journey into West London for eight, epic, unadulterated hours for A Night With…

FREE SOUL CLAP MIX

As part of their extensive Efunk Album tour, which has taken them from Miami, Rome, Paris, New York and Berlin, unleashing the Soul Clap signature sound, leaving people grooving and moving together in intergalactic harmony.  Efunk (Everybody´s Freaky Under Natures Kingdom) is the duo’s debut album released on Wolf+Lamb and shows them teaming up with a few close friends. Outside of the studio and back on the dance-floor the boys have a very special summer mapped out picking up the baton as new residents of Ibiza’s finest DC10.

The last couple of years have borne witness to the rise and rise of the Soul Clap phenomenon. Remix masters at work, they push out a mixture of influences that texture their original productions as well as their famous colourful edits. Influenced from the likes of Larry Levan and David Mancuso, infamous for playing outside of specific labels and genres, Soul Clap sets are something of a variety show roller-coaster, which change BPMs, genres and emotions throughout, something which is a signature from the Wolf+Lamb experience. Be prepared for ups and downs, smiles and frowns.  Free your mind, and your ass will follow.

A Night With…Soul Clap will take place at the stunning Loft Studios on Scrubs Lane in West London.

VIDEO Recap | Circoloco In The Arena, Birmingham

From pure party lovers to industry insiders and DJs, there was a certain sense of excitement in the air for the bank holiday treat. Across one weekend a long list of house and techno talents including Visionquest, Jamie Jones, Kerri Chandler, Cassy, Matthias Tanzmann, The Martinez Brothers and many more were hitting the brummy city to party at new venue, The Arena, as well as the beloved Rainbow complex.

On April 6th the event that everyone had been talking about for weeks finally began. Circoloco is arguably one of the most illustrious parties in the world that serves daytime revelry lovers of those in the know and, of course, the most cutting edge music. The Easter celebration saw three typically off the wall events programmed in club spaces old and new across the city, with line-ups jam packed with on-point talents from across the house and techno spectrum.

A huge part of the event surrounded the launch of the brand new and impressive Arena. As well as mind melting lights and pyrotechnics, the space was decked out with heavy sound systems to ensure we could enjoy every high-hat, bass rumble and melodic pulse dished out to us. The space itself is a collection of Victorian railway arches under the over-reaching curve of The Rainbow’s embrace and somehow mimics the architecture of an ancient Coliseum. It held up to 5,000 ravers, and was no doubt one of the city’s most essential rave spaces that weekend. DJs included ‘Loco favorites Jamie Jones, Kerri Chandler, Matthias Tanzmann, Dyed Soundorom, Dan Ghenacia, Cassy, The Martinez Brothers and Below main man Adam Shelton.

Next, it was on to a warehouse at just past midnight where the sensational Hot Natured (aka Jamie Jones and Lee Foss) took us through to 7am with a back to back set. Label mates Luca C and Ali Love as well as Clockwork and Richy Ahmed also played, pouring out plenty of creamy house sounds right through the night. To finish off the Spring-time extravaganza, Below took the reins in The Courtyard, which comes complete with natural light, exposed brick work and trees for an open air day time special.  This time the party ran from midday until 3am and was headlined by one of the biggest teams in the game, Visionquest (Shaun Reeves, Lee Curtiss and Ryan Crosson). Of course, local night Below also had their residents out to play and founder Adam Shelton got behind the decks, along with One Records co-chief, Subb-an.

DC10’s Circo Loco is amongst the most sought after party brands with multiple residencies around the world at the foremost temples of dance music, leading festivals and conferences on all continents. We were lucky enough to have them travel from the hedonistic island to warm us up on our rain sodden shores, for a weekend that’s surely going in the books as one of the most exciting clubbing prospects to have hit Birmingham in years. With an open air background, up for it crowd and even a sit-down all soundtracked to cutting edge underground beats, we captured the quintessential moments of this famous brands gift to UK, but before the “Big One” hits your screens, here’s a little preview of what went down…

EVENT | We Are Industry Part 1

While the Queen will be getting down and dirty celebrating 60 years on the thrown, Industry are set to host the first of their “We Are Industry” events in Birmingham. On June 3rd, they’ll be bringing live shows from Booka Shade and Carl Craig alongside DJ sets from Dubfire, Burnski, DJ T. and more for a one-off outdoor all day party.

Street Party
Sunday 3rd June, 12pm-12am
Floodgate Street
Digbeth
Birmingham
B5 5SR

Both Booka Shade and Carl Craig continue to thrill audiences with their unique approaches to live electronic music. Booka Shade, having not graced UK decks for some time other than one brief appearance this year, will no doubt give fans exactly what they’re looking for. Under the many guises that Carl Craig has released as during the years, some of his most respected output has come from his 69 project. He’ll be revisiting this classic period as homage to the genius that has cemented his reputation as one of the finest purveyors of techno.

Shirazinia aka Dubfire has established himself as one of the forerunners of the scene, releasing polished techno on labels such as Desolat, Minus and Cocoon before founding his own label SCI + TEC. Completing the line-up is DJ T., whose background as a DJ, label owner, producer, club operator, publisher and journalist has put him in excellent stride for his breakthrough as an artist in his own right. He’ll be supported by the sounds of Burnski, Maxxi Sound System and a special set from Antonio Vendone B2B Adam Curtain.

A bank holiday special can’t go without an afterparty. ‘We Are Industry’ will be driving the party on through the evening at a secret location from 11pm – 6am, with the likes of Manik B2B Burnski, Huxley, WiLDKATS, Ben Pearce and Paddy Lopaski.

My Favorite Robot Q&A

What feeling/atmosphere did you intend for the podcast?

Some cool music on here from the MFR label and some other stuff we’ve been playing recently. The mix is deep and moody and comes from outer space!

What is your favorite track on it?

The second track on the mix, ‘perfect pairs’ is a really solid track – one of our favorites so far this year!

What is your favorite track at the moment?

‘Time’ from the Pachanga boys is one that we’ve been playing out for a little while now…great tune!

What do you have coming up, any new releases due out?

Yes…look for our tracks ‘Barricade’ and ‘The Waiting Rain’ in May on Life & Death with great remixes from Photek, Mano Le Tough and DJ Tennis. We also have an EP on Sasha’s Last Night On Earth scheduled for June.

Where can we catch you playing next?

We should be in Europe and the UK a bit this summer, dates are being confirmed but you can catch us at the Circoloco DC10 opening party on May 28th, or at our Sonar MFR Label Showcase at Macarena Club on June 12th.

Any artists who you are really interested in at the moment?

We have just signed the first 2 album projects to our label, My Favorite Robot Records and are really excited by those artists & projects. Look for a lot more in the coming weeks and months from us on Jori Hulkkonen & Sid Le Rock…two of our ‘favorites’!

FEATURE | Right-Hand Records: Nitin

Nitin’s love affair with Techno & House is clearly the platform to which he belongs to be standing on. An unostentatious artist with a sophisticated sound and attitude to the world of underground music, his stance in the industry is becoming clearer and more prominent by the hour.

His career has spanned over 15 years bringing him from Coast to Coast where he has delivered beats with some of the top DJs in the world regularly sharing the decks with M.A.N.D.Y, Damian Lazarus, Jamie Jones, and Audiofly. He is considered to be a key player in the recent explosion of Toronto artists on the world and one of the men who make the magic happen for Canadian imprint, No.19 Music with label partner Jonny White of Art Department. So, after a life in music and now A&R for a label that is rapidly becoming a global underground gem, it’s undeniable this man knows a thing or two about music – which tracks will he never let go of and why? Over to Nitin…

Ron Trent – Morning Factory

Prescription is definitely up there as one of my top house labels of all time. This song being my favourite. Its simple, hypnotic, druggy and in my opinion this track is perfect for most occasions, that’s why its always in the rotation. Truth be told I used to play this track from half way through as I’m more a fan of this track less the spoken word vocals in the front half of it. I’ve recently acquired the dubplate version which is a full instrumental

Kerri Chandler – Atmospheric Beats

Kerri has hands down made some of the greatest house songs of all time. This song is always a hit for me. If I’m playing this tune it means I’m having a good time. It’s uplifting yet driving, house music at its finest.

M5 Basic Channel – I love Maurizio

Basic Chanel and everything else that has spawned from them, really. This cut in particular has that distinctive sub bass that you recognise as soon as you put it on. You always hope there’s someone in the crowd who runs up and is very happy to be hearing this. That always puts a smile on my face ☺ Its also a track I like to layer things on top of like an acappella or some crazy vocal track. Its one of the best DJ tools ever.

Robert Owens – Bring down the Walls

Gotta be one of my favourite songs by the powerhouse duo of Larry Heard and Robert Owens. This song was my introduction to Robert Owens amazing vocals and Larry Heard’s production. Of course when I did first hear this I didn’t fully grasp how important these two guys are. It was something I would discover after a few years. This is house music in its rawest form in my humbled opinion. I discovered it well after it came out and always thought it would have been amazing to be clubbing when this first came out. Of course I was only 8 years old when that happened so chances were slim.

Metro Area – Muira

This track is the perfect balance of retro and future sounds. I felt nostalgic the first time I heard this record. Definitely one that stays with me at all times. Morgan Geist and Envron have always been a step ahead of the times. I’ve been a fan for quite some time. I had to buy and additional copy of this on wax as I played the shit out of the first copy.
